User contributions for Dereckson
From Nasqueron Agora
3 April 2023
- 00:2500:25, 3 April 2023 diff hist +385 N Db-A-001 Created page with "'''db-A-001''' is a PostgreSQL server for Nasqueron Datasources. == Useful links == * Operations grimoire/PostgreSQL for howto and the databases we host * [https://devcentral.nasqueron.org/source/operations/browse/main/pillar/dbserver/cluster-A.sls PostgreSQL configuration] * [https://netbox.nasqueron.org/virtualization/virtual-machines/3/ NetBox] 🔒 Category:Servers"
- 00:2400:24, 3 April 2023 diff hist +18 Operations grimoire →Core services
- 00:2200:22, 3 April 2023 diff hist +451 N Docker-002 Created page with "Docker Engine for production services. Supersedes Equatower and docker-001. == Properties == * Hypervisor: hyper-001 * Network ** IP - drake: 172.27.27.5 ** IP - public: 51.255.124.9 == Useful links == * [https://devcentral.nasqueron.org/source/operations/browse/main/pillar/paas/docker/docker-002/ Docker and containers configuration] * [https://netbox.nasqueron.org/virtualization/virtual-machines/7/ NetBox] 🔒 Category:Servers" current
- 00:1600:16, 3 April 2023 diff hist +2 Main Page →Nasqueron
2 April 2023
- 23:5523:55, 2 April 2023 diff hist +422 Main Page →Servers: complector/db/router
- 23:5223:52, 2 April 2023 diff hist +35 N Datasources Redirected page to Nasqueron Datasources current Tag: New redirect
- 22:0122:01, 2 April 2023 diff hist +268 Operations grimoire/Deploy with Salt Complector current
- 11:3011:30, 2 April 2023 diff hist +127 Operations grimoire/Sentry →Kafka
- 10:1710:17, 2 April 2023 diff hist −14 Operations grimoire/Kafka Changed redirect target from Operations grimoire/Sentry#Kafka and ZooKeeper to Operations grimoire/Sentry#Kafka current Tag: Redirect target changed
- 10:1610:16, 2 April 2023 diff hist +60 N Operations grimoire/Kafka Redirected page to Operations grimoire/Sentry#Kafka and ZooKeeper Tag: New redirect
- 10:1610:16, 2 April 2023 diff hist +13 Operations grimoire →Core services
1 April 2023
- 20:0420:04, 1 April 2023 diff hist +2,200 N Operations grimoire/Environments Created page with "Most complex infrastructures use the concept of ''environment'' to separate the servers or the deployments in silos and be able to test what's desired as infrastructure changes before it reaches production. This page documents how this concept of environment is used at Nasqueron. In a nutshell, we separate servers in dev vs prod, with legacy devservers serving both content. Those dev and prod servers are ONE infrastructure, and there is no staging/preprod/qa/uat to mim..." current
- 19:4919:49, 1 April 2023 diff hist +20 Operations grimoire →Infrastructure
29 March 2023
- 19:1119:11, 29 March 2023 diff hist +1,548 N Operations grimoire/PostgreSQL Created page with "PostgreSQL is available as a standalone role and can also be enabled on devserver. Applications on the Docker PaaS can use our PostgreSQL infrastructure (Airflow, datasources) or have their own container (Sentry, with custom wal2json extension). This resource documents our own db- servers. == Howto == === Open a console === Use peer authentication from the postgres user: <code>sudo -u postgres psql</code> === Create a new database or user === It's a simple two step..."
27 March 2023
- 16:0616:06, 27 March 2023 diff hist +2,199 Operations grimoire/Sentry →Kafka
- 15:5915:59, 27 March 2023 diff hist +3,127 Operations grimoire/Sentry No edit summary
25 March 2023
- 09:5009:50, 25 March 2023 diff hist +430 Operations grimoire/Sentry Update process
- 09:2009:20, 25 March 2023 diff hist 0 m Operations grimoire/Sentry →Deployment of Sentry containers: D2907
- 09:1909:19, 25 March 2023 diff hist +624 Operations grimoire/Sentry Upgrade to 23.4.0.dev
12 March 2023
- 10:4510:45, 12 March 2023 diff hist 0 Operations grimoire/Sentry →Deployment of Sentry containers
- 10:4510:45, 12 March 2023 diff hist +845 Operations grimoire/Sentry No edit summary
10 March 2023
- 10:0010:00, 10 March 2023 diff hist +283 Operations grimoire/External services GeoLite2
9 March 2023
- 23:5523:55, 9 March 2023 diff hist +501 Operations grimoire/Sentry No edit summary
3 March 2023
- 19:3619:36, 3 March 2023 diff hist −4 Operations grimoire/TLS certificates certbot everywhere
- 17:5317:53, 3 March 2023 diff hist +153 Operations grimoire/Onboarding →Onboarding current
2 March 2023
- 17:1617:16, 2 March 2023 diff hist +130 Operations grimoire/Etherpad →API key issue
- 17:1517:15, 2 March 2023 diff hist +143 Operations grimoire/Etherpad No edit summary
- 16:2916:29, 2 March 2023 diff hist +150 Operations grimoire/Contacts Wolfplex blanket approval current
- 11:0311:03, 2 March 2023 diff hist −11 Operations grimoire/Etherpad →API key issue: Path update to /var/dataroot
- 10:5910:59, 2 March 2023 diff hist −342 Operations grimoire/Etherpad No edit summary
- 10:5010:50, 2 March 2023 diff hist +40 N Operations grimoire/Netbox Dereckson moved page Operations grimoire/Netbox to Operations grimoire/NetBox: Product case according NetBox own documentation current Tag: New redirect
- 10:5010:50, 2 March 2023 diff hist 0 m Operations grimoire/NetBox Dereckson moved page Operations grimoire/Netbox to Operations grimoire/NetBox: Product case according NetBox own documentation
- 10:4910:49, 2 March 2023 diff hist +14 Operations grimoire →Services
- 10:4910:49, 2 March 2023 diff hist +704 N Operations grimoire/NetBox Created page with "NetBox is the current source of truth for the network. It's available at [https://netbox.nasqueron.org NetBox]. == Integration with Salt == Ongoing integration projects are in work to serve NetBox data as part of Salt pillar for configuration as code. It should serve: * /etc/hosts data for Drake network machines * the same information available at pillar/nodes/nodes.sls, so we won't need to maintain that anymore == Conventions == === Devices === ==== Device role color..."
- 10:4510:45, 2 March 2023 diff hist −7 Operations grimoire/Network No edit summary
21 February 2023
- 06:3606:36, 21 February 2023 diff hist +12 Operations grimoire/Onboarding →Onboarding
- 00:0300:03, 21 February 2023 diff hist +1,329 Privacy/Records of processing activities +Geo current
20 February 2023
- 23:5323:53, 20 February 2023 diff hist +3,255 N Privacy/Geo Created page with "This policy applies to personal identity information shared on the geo.nasqueron.org services. It hosts a Hauk server, to allow physical location sharing through the Hauk Android application. This private policy describes the policies and procedures on the collection, use and disclosure of the information. ''Last updated: 2023-02-20.'' === Type of data collected === Personally identifiable information may include, but is not limited to: ; Hauk * IP addresses * Your..." current
17 February 2023
- 00:5000:50, 17 February 2023 diff hist −2 Operations grimoire/Onboarding →Request
- 00:3700:37, 17 February 2023 diff hist +1,203 N Operations grimoire/Onboarding Created page with "The current '''Nasqueron Operations SIG onboarding process''' is still a work in progress. When onboarding new members, this process should be refined and improve. == Request == To join the Nasqueron Operations SIG: * Create a task on Phabricator ** Document the work previously done for Nasqueron projet, with focus on the infrastructure, state you want to join Operations. ** Tag it ''Nasqueron Operations Squad'' ** Announce the task on Libera #nasqueron-ops * When invi..."
16 February 2023
- 23:0823:08, 16 February 2023 diff hist +29 Operations grimoire →Checklists
5 February 2023
- 10:1310:13, 5 February 2023 diff hist +279 Hyper-001 →Upgrade procedure current
4 February 2023
- 22:0722:07, 4 February 2023 diff hist +238 Operations grimoire/Network NetBox
- 20:5720:57, 4 February 2023 diff hist −2 Operations grimoire/Network →172.27.27.0/28
- 16:0616:06, 4 February 2023 diff hist +71 Operations grimoire/Incidents/2023-02-03-ESXi +complector current
- 15:3515:35, 4 February 2023 diff hist +1,293 N Operations grimoire/Incidents/2023-02-03-ESXi Created page with "Not tracked on DevCentral as docker-001 is currently down. == Incident timeline == ; 2023-02-03 * 16:28:03 Dorian and Dereckson worked on pad.nasqueron.org, connection was stopped * 16:29:06 Hypervisor Dreadnought is confirmed working, attack against VMWare ESXi detected, server switched in rescue mode * 00:15:40 hyper-001 provisioned ; 2023-02-04 * 12:58:36 migration from Dreadnought to hyper-001 done for router-001 == Analysis == External sources: * https://www...."
- 11:2711:27, 4 February 2023 diff hist +69 Complector No edit summary current
- 11:2611:26, 4 February 2023 diff hist +266 N Complector Created page with "'''Complector''' (complector.nasqueron.drake) has two roles: - '''salt-primary''', acts as a source of configuration for other servers - '''vault''', stores secrets It doesn't have a public address, servers can reach it at 172.27.27.7. Category:Servers"
- 09:4409:44, 4 February 2023 diff hist +30 Dreadnought Superseded by hyper-001 current
- 09:4409:44, 4 February 2023 diff hist +1,076 N Hyper-001 Created page with "The server '''hyper-001''' is an hypervisor hosted at OVH (GRA). It hosts infrastructures servers like router-001, db-A-001, Complector. It supersedes Dreadnought. * '''OS:''' VMware vSphere Hypervisor 7 * '''CPU:''' AMD EPYC 7351P 16-Core Processor, 16 core, 32 logical processors * '''RAM:''' 128 GB RAM * '''Datastore''': 3.51 TB (Soft RAID 2x) '''Netbox:''' https://netbox.nasqueron.org/dcim/devices/1/ == Troubleshoot == === Upgrade procedure === A..."
3 February 2023
- 23:3323:33, 3 February 2023 diff hist 0 Operations grimoire/Network →Other network ranges: switch t /16
- 16:1816:18, 3 February 2023 diff hist +1 m IRC No edit summary
- 16:1716:17, 3 February 2023 diff hist +446 IRC No edit summary
24 January 2023
- 05:0005:00, 24 January 2023 diff hist +223 Operations grimoire/Network →172.27.27.0/28: Assign
23 January 2023
- 12:1512:15, 23 January 2023 diff hist +52 Operations grimoire/Vault →Troubleshoot
- 12:1012:10, 23 January 2023 diff hist +1,509 Operations grimoire/Vault →Certificates
- 11:3611:36, 23 January 2023 diff hist +1,163 Operations grimoire/Vault →Certificates: Draft procedures
- 09:5309:53, 23 January 2023 diff hist +92 Operations grimoire/Vault →= Renew Vault HTTP certificates
- 09:5209:52, 23 January 2023 diff hist +838 Operations grimoire/Vault →Troubleshoot
- 09:3409:34, 23 January 2023 diff hist 0 m Operations grimoire/Vault →Connecting to Vault
18 January 2023
- 01:4901:49, 18 January 2023 diff hist +122 Fantoir-datasource →Fetch: Code update current
- 01:4201:42, 18 January 2023 diff hist +1 m Nasqueron Datasources No edit summary current
15 January 2023
- 06:5506:55, 15 January 2023 diff hist +31 N Template:Clear Created page with "<div style="clear: both"></div>" current
- 06:5406:54, 15 January 2023 diff hist +10 Fantoir-datasource →Recommended workflow
- 06:5306:53, 15 January 2023 diff hist +103 Fantoir-datasource →Database setup
- 06:5206:52, 15 January 2023 diff hist +28 Main Page →Projects
- 06:2006:20, 15 January 2023 diff hist +1,111 Fantoir-datasource No edit summary
- 06:0906:09, 15 January 2023 diff hist +1,586 N Fantoir-datasource Created page with "The <code>fantoir-datasource</code> tool allows to import and manage FANTOIR datasource. == Usage == <source> $ fantoir-datasource help Import FANTOIR database into PostgreSQL Usage: fantoir-datasource <COMMAND> Commands: fetch Fetch the last version of the FANTOIR file import Import from FANTOIR file generated by the DGFIP promote Promote an imported FANTOIR table as the current FANTOIR table to use wikidata Query Wikidata SPARQL end-point to enri..."
- 06:0006:00, 15 January 2023 diff hist −409 Nasqueron Datasources →FANTOIR (fantoir-datasource)
- 01:5601:56, 15 January 2023 diff hist −4 Nasqueron Datasources →FANTOIR (fantoir-datasource)
- 01:5601:56, 15 January 2023 diff hist +470 Nasqueron Datasources →FANTOIR (fantoir-datasource)
- 01:5401:54, 15 January 2023 diff hist +135 Nasqueron Datasources →FANTOIR (fantoir-datasource)
14 January 2023
- 21:0221:02, 14 January 2023 diff hist +2,343 N Nasqueron Datasources Draft
- 20:4120:41, 14 January 2023 diff hist +220 Software No edit summary current
11 January 2023
- 00:2600:26, 11 January 2023 diff hist +1,974 N Software Created page with "{{DISPLAYTITLE:<span style="color:white;width:0;font-size:0;">{{FULLPAGENAME}}</span>}} <div class="block user-block"> <div style="font-size: 3.75em; margin-bottom: 0.5em;" class="color-magnetic-five center">Nasqueron :: Software</div> <div style="font-size: 3em; margin-bottom: 10vh;" class="color-magnetic-five center">Open source project</div> <div> <div class="block-col block-col-half"> ; Notifications Center The Notifications center is an intelligent bus to receiv..."
- 00:2500:25, 11 January 2023 diff hist +312 N Notifications center/Web client Created page with "The Notifications center web client is under development with two components: * a SSE server, https://devcentral.nasqueron.org/D2718 * a JS client to read them and show them on https://infra.nasqueron.org For more information, you can discuss the proof of concept on https://devcentral.nasqueron.org/T1682." current
- 00:2100:21, 11 January 2023 diff hist +991 Notifications center No edit summary current
- 00:0900:09, 11 January 2023 diff hist +63 Notifications center No edit summary
10 January 2023
- 22:4722:47, 10 January 2023 diff hist +197 MediaWiki:Common.css Typography and margin for user pages dt
21 December 2022
- 20:3320:33, 21 December 2022 diff hist +38 API →Services index current
- 19:4819:48, 21 December 2022 diff hist +2,159 N API Created page with "Nasqueron API is divided in small microservices, with endpoints offered at https://api.nasqueron.org == Services index == {| class="wikitable sortable" |+ Services |- ! Name !! Mount point !! Description !! Front-end !! Repository !! Language / framework |- | Docker Registry API || /docker/registry || Nasqueron Docker PaaS private registry content || https://infra.nasqueron.org/docker/registry/ || [https://devcentral.nasqueron.org/source/docker-registry-api/ rAPIREG] |..."
- 19:0419:04, 21 December 2022 diff hist +34 Main Page →Projects
- 19:0419:04, 21 December 2022 diff hist +27 Main Page →Projects
7 July 2022
- 21:4621:46, 7 July 2022 diff hist +147 User:Dereckson/Tracker →Games: +Novalis
3 July 2022
- 21:4221:42, 3 July 2022 diff hist −77 User:Dereckson/Tracker No edit summary
27 May 2022
- 09:1709:17, 27 May 2022 diff hist 0 Dwellers No edit summary
19 May 2022
- 18:0818:08, 19 May 2022 diff hist −9 User:Dereckson/Tracker -FixFox
8 May 2022
- 11:5911:59, 8 May 2022 diff hist +123 Jenkins →Old-style jobs current
7 May 2022
- 23:0423:04, 7 May 2022 diff hist +839 Jenkins +Jenkins CLI, reload job
- 18:1218:12, 7 May 2022 diff hist +64 User:Dereckson/Tracker +https://www.rockpapershotgun.com/wytchwood-review
- 17:5817:58, 7 May 2022 diff hist +86 User:Dereckson/Tracker No edit summary
- 17:4717:47, 7 May 2022 diff hist +27 User:Dereckson/Tracker →Games
30 April 2022
- 12:0112:01, 30 April 2022 diff hist +261 User:Dereckson/Tracker →Games
19 April 2022
- 22:3022:30, 19 April 2022 diff hist +80 Code conventions →All languages
10 April 2022
- 12:2612:26, 10 April 2022 diff hist +2,274 Devserver reference Some doc, T1718 or BSD general notes
9 April 2022
- 11:4411:44, 9 April 2022 diff hist −5 Main Page →Services
- 11:4311:43, 9 April 2022 diff hist +1,724 N Devserver reference Created page with "Nasqueron Operations SIG maintains '''devservers'''. They offer a remote development environment for Nasqueron and open source projects. == General information == === What server to use? === * WindRiver, for any general-purpose task * Ysul, for webserver-legacy sites * Dwellers, for Docker development * Eglide, if you need an IRC session === How to get access? === {{Call for action | link = https://devcentral.nasqueron.org/maniphest/task/edit/form/3/ | text = Req..."
5 April 2022
- 14:4214:42, 5 April 2022 diff hist +25 Operations grimoire/Create and revoke user accounts on Salt servers →Create an user: .py
1 April 2022
- 19:5919:59, 1 April 2022 diff hist +296 Operations grimoire/Create and revoke user accounts on Salt servers →Run the Salt
26 March 2022
- 11:5311:53, 26 March 2022 diff hist +7 m Operations grimoire/Vault →Connecting to Vault: code tag